BLU announced the launch of the Dash 3.5 II smartphone in 2013. The manufacturer is offering this smartphone with 3.5 inch TFT display, Mediatek MT6572M SoC, and 256 MB of RAM. It comes with Android OS v4.4 (KitKat) out of the box, and a Li-Ion 1450 mAh battery. The 3.5 inch phone comes with a TFT display (320 x 480 px). BLU Dash 3.5 II specifications

BrandBLU
NameDash 3.5 II
ModelD352
Release date2013

Weight, dimensions, colors

Weight3.92 oz
Dimensions4.62 x 2.43 x 0.5 inch
Colorsblack, blue, gold, orange, pink, white, yellow
SIM typeMini SIM

The weight of BLU Dash 3.5 II is about 3.92 oz with battery. This is average for smartphones of the same size.

System, chipset, performance

OS versionAndroid OS v4.4 (KitKat)
SoCMediatek MT6572M
CPUDual-core 1 GHz Cortex-A7
GPUMali-400

The BLU Dash 3.5 II comes with Android OS v4.4 (KitKat) out of the box. Google has integrated many services with Android. These include Google Maps, Gmail, and Google Drive. This Mediatek MT6572M CPU can be fast enough for basic phone operations. Many mobile devices use ARM Mali GPUs. They are well known for their good performance and power efficiency.

Display type, size, resolution

Display typeTFT
Screen size3.5 inch
Resolution320 x 480 px
Multitouch supportyes

The 3.5 inch phone comes with TFT display. A thin-film transistor (TFT) features a thin-film transistor for each individual pixel. Smaller smartphones are generally more compact and easier to handle. The size of the screen is measured diagonally, from corner to corner.

Memory, storage

RAM256 MB
Internal storage512 MB
Memory card slotmicroSD

256 MB of RAM is not typically considered to be enough for a smartphone. Having more RAM alone does not guarantee better performance. Most people think a smartphone needs at least 32 GB of storage. The Dash 3.5 II has only 512 MB. You can expand the internal storage (512 MB) with a compatible microSD card.

Cameras, flash

Main camera3.15 MP, 2048 x 1536 px
FlashLED
Selfie cameraVGA

The single camera can be enough for many smartphone users. It depends on their photography needs and preferences. The Dash 3.5 II does not have optical image stabilization (OIS).

Connectivity, network, wireless

GSM 2G bands850 / 900 / 1800 / 1900
Network coverage2G / 3G / 4G
Wi-FiWi-Fi 802.11 b/g/n
Bluetoothv3.0
GPSA-GPS
NFCno
FM radiono
USBmicroUSB 2.0
Headphone3.5 mm jack

The BLU Dash 3.5 II supports 4G/LTE networks. This phone like all modern smartphones, is capable of connecting to Wi-Fi networks. The Dash 3.5 II smartphone is capable of connecting to Bluetooth devices. This phone has a built-in GPS. The phone isn't NFC (Near Field Communication) capable. NFC is not essential for basic phone functionality, but it can be useful. The 3.5 mm headphone jack allows you to connect wired headphones or earphones to the device.

Battery type, capacity, charger

TypeLi-Ion 1450 mAh

The Li-Ion 1450 mAh battery gives the smartphone a good battery backup. The Li-ion is a low maintenance battery. It does not need periodic full discharge. You can simply buy a new battery from the open market and interchange it by yourself.
